Signs of brainstem ***** include

A. Unconsciousness.

B. Loss of pupillary reaction to light.

C. Loss of tendon jerks in the arms and legs.

D. Loss of respiratory response to CO2 in the absence of hypoxia.

E. Nystagmus in response to cold water in the external auditory canal.

A. False Consciousness is a function of the cerebral cortical neurones.

B. True The coordinating centres for pupillary reflexes are in the brainstem.

C. False The reflex centres for tendon jerks are in the spinal cord.

D. True Respiratory reflexes are coordinated in the brainstem.

E. False Nystagmus is the normal reflex response of brainstem centres to this stimulus.
